We took note of the drive’s temperature during some of our benchmarking runs. Lexar claims that the heatsink version of the Professional NM800 Pro can reduce temperatures by up to 30%. It certainly seemed to work very well. The hottest the drive got while testing was 39°C, which is comfortably well short of the official maximum operating temperature of 70°C.
